Transponder Key
If your car has transponder keys, they're going to cost more to replace than a standard key. The keys are equipped with chips that communicate with the vehicle to turn it on or shut the doors. The key replacement car has to be programmed correctly in order to function. It is usually much less expensive to have a transponder key replaced by an auto locksmith than at the dealer.
Car dealerships will also charge a premium for replacing these keys since they are the only ones to create them for their customers. If you want to save money on a replacement key for your car, try searching online for locksmith services that specialize in your particular vehicle model. They'll likely be able to both program your transponder chip and cut you an ordinary car key.
The chips were first introduced to vehicles in 1998 and are designed to reduce car thefts by stopping people from hot wiring a car which doesn't have the correct key. The chips function by sending an information from the key to the vehicle's ignition. The chip has a serial code that authenticates the key and makes it work. This helps to prevent thieves from using fake keys and stealing keys.
Modern cars are equipped with chip keys and a traditional flat metal key that can open the door and operate locks in the event of need. The two keys are typically separated and are used in emergencies or as a backup.
You can buy a blank transponder key from a local hardware store, such as Home Depot or Walmart, at a reasonable cost for replacement car key. These keys will not start your car however, they can be used to unlock your doors if you are locked out. Some keys are compatible with certain car immobilizer systems that will stop your vehicle from starting if a key that is not compatible is used.

Keyless Entry Remote
With a key fob, you can lock and start your car even if the metal key is not in the ignition. This style of key is typically used in modern European vehicles and can cost between $200 and $500 to replace. The rolling-code encryption stops thieves from copying the keys and stealing vehicles. Typically, these kinds of keys have to be replaced by dealers and cannot be copied by hardware stores.
The cost of replacing a traditional key fob with a simple button to unlock the door is usually between $20 to $50. However they are a frequent target for thieves, so it is important to have a backup mechanical key in addition. The latest transponder keys are slightly more expensive, and ranges between $100 to $150. However, they do have additional security features that make them less likely for theft.
The most advanced form of key fob is the smart key, which is the same size as a regular key and houses the key in plastic that pops out when a button is pressed. This type of key is the most difficult to steal and is often coupled with other premium features like navigation systems in higher trim levels or technology packages. Smart keys can cost between $250 and $500.
Some of these newer key fobs can be copied by hardware stores, but others need to be ordered through a dealer.
